Southwest Philadelphia, Philadelphia, PA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Southwest Philadelphia?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Southwest Philadelphia Studio Apartments | $1,541 | $850 | $3,443 |
| Southwest Philadelphia 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,496 | $925 | $2,850 |
| Southwest Philadelphia 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,062 | $975 | $3,625 |
| Southwest Philadelphia 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,158 | $1,350 | $3,010 |
| Southwest Philadelphia 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,500 | $1,500 | $1,500 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Southwest Philadelphia Apartments with Swimming Pool
What is the Cheapest Swimming Pool apartment in Southwest Philadelphia?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Southwest Philadelphia with Swimming Pool is at Gateway Towers listed at $1,235.
How much is the average rent for Southwest Philadelphia Apartments with Swimming Pool?
The average rent for a Apartment in Southwest Philadelphia with Swimming Pool is $2,174.
What is the largest Southwest Philadelphia Apartment for rent with Swimming Pool?
Today's Apartment with Swimming Pool and the most square footage in Southwest Philadelphia is a 1,400 square feet unit starting from $1,600 at 1311 S 52nd St, Unit 4.
What is the average size for Southwest Philadelphia Apartments for rent with Swimming Pool?
The average size for a rental with Swimming Pool in Southwest Philadelphia is currently at 1,030 sq ft.
